In this context, the concepts of accountability and ethics become increasingly complex. When AI systems recommend a course of action that leads to adverse outcomes, the question of responsibility looms large. Who is to blame: the algorithm, the designer, or the user?
Moreover, the biases inherent in AI systems present another significant concern. If the data used to train these algorithms reflects historical prejudices or systemic inequalities, the decisions they generate will perpetuate those same biases. This phenomenon can lead to outcomes that are not only flawed but also harmful—compounding existing disparities rather than alleviating them. The promise of AI-enhanced decision making can quickly devolve into a tool for reinforcing the status quo, unless vigilant oversight and ethical frameworks are established.
